Hi all and welcome back to the Irish Tennis Updates Podcast. Thanks for joining me again.

Today I am lucky enough to be talking to Peter Bothwell, current pro player with a carrer high singles ranking of 602, and Irish Open champion in 2018.

I was really excited to be talking to Peter. We chat about what it was like to be at an event when everything was called off, how visualization has helped him turn his singles form around, how he nearly but didn't go to college in the US, what is was like playing Medvedev and Tsitsipas, why he had to wear a tennis dress, and much more!
